Classic Garlic Bread Focaccia You Can’t Resist!

A delicious and irresistible garlic bread focaccia that combines the flavors of garlic and herbs with a soft, fluffy texture.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up warm water
  • 2 teaspoons active dry yeast
  • 1 teaspoon sugar
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per

Instructions

  1. In a bowl, combine warm water, yeast, and sugar. Let it sit for 5 minutes until frothy.
  2. Add flour, salt, and olive oil to the yeast mixture. Mix until a dough forms.
  3. Knead the dough on a floured surface for about 5 minutes until smooth.
  4. Place the dough in a greased bowl, cover, and let it rise for 1 hour or until doubled in size.
  5.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  6. Once risen, punch down the dough and spread it onto a greased baking sheet.
  7. In a small bowl, mix minced garlic, parsley, oregano, and black pepper. Spread this mixture over the dough.
  8. Bake for 20-25 minutes or until golden brown.
  9. Let it cool slightly before slicing and serving.

Notes

  • For extra flavor, you can add grated Parmesan cheese on top before baking.
  • Serve warm for the best taste.
  • This focaccia can be stored in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
